Cars acquired!

   Within the past two weeks I have purchased a 1988 Ford Festiva with 200k miles on it for $900 it has a carbuerated 1.3 SOHC and 4 speed manual transmission. the body is in overall good shape for the year and mileage. the "frame rails" are completely rotted and will need replaced but the floorboard and body are in excellent condition. It is rather quite odd looking at the frame rails as it looks like someone had a perfectly good car and slapped  little sheet metal rails underneath. I will probably not worry about them as the cage will take the stress from that area not that by looking at the frame rails they did anything productive anyways.
    I have also picked up a 1991 Mercury Capri XR2 with 125k miles on it for $600, it has the Mazda B6T engine and 5 speed transmission I need for the swap. The Capri has a rough idle but runs very strong. I actually am a bit concerned of having too much power in the Festiva now as even with the Capri almost 1000lb heavier it is quick for what it is. I would actually compare it to a B16 swapped civic (that is my main motivation for this swap is I miss my 92 B18C1 turboed hatch, but I don't miss the cost of Honda parts) On a side note have you ever bought a donor car that was better shape than the project car?
